Transaction 31f41bd55b686ca661da06a6720a5dc8991fb97cbf297a88f784d7beeb455126

1 Input
2 Outputs
  • 31f41bd55b686ca661da06a6720a5dc8991fb97cbf297a88f784d7beeb455126:0
  • value  36950
    address  183SBHBXRLukUsqiypWp2xLwWR5HAgbQsq
  • 31f41bd55b686ca661da06a6720a5dc8991fb97cbf297a88f784d7beeb455126:1
  • value  255740
    address  35WCyX2QzUYW31nhqYqbxZjBjdgPJF4ePG